Getting There

  • Car

    If you are traveling by car, navigate to Willey House located at 2057 US-302, Hart's Location, NH 03812. From North Conway, take NH-16 South to US-302 West. Continue on US-302 for about 10 miles. The Willey House will be on your right. There is ample parking available on-site. Be mindful of the speed limits along the route, as they vary.

  • Public Transportation

    For those using public transportation, take a bus from North Conway to the nearest bus stop on US-302. The route may require a transfer at the junction of NH-16 and US-302, so check the local bus schedules from the Mount Washington Valley Transit Authority. Once you arrive at the bus stop, you will need to walk approximately 0.5 miles along US-302 to reach the Willey House. Plan for a longer travel time due to bus schedules and transfers.

  • Bicycle

    For adventurous tourists, cycling to Willey House can be a scenic option. Start from North Conway and follow the bike paths leading to US-302. The ride is approximately 10 miles and mostly downhill, offering beautiful views of the surrounding landscape. Be sure to wear a helmet and stay on designated bike paths where available.

  • Walking

    If you are staying nearby and prefer to walk, you can follow US-302 from Hart's Location. Depending on your starting point, this could be a longer trek, so ensure you have proper footwear and water. Always walk facing traffic and be mindful of road safety.
